Expanding Digital Wallet Accessibility
Accessibility in the realm of digital transactions is pivotal. It not only encompasses the ease of use but also the broadening of access to individuals who might be digitally disadvantaged. This includes creating platforms that are intuitive for users with varied levels of digital literacy and ensuring these platforms are secure against potential threats.
The cornerstone of hypoallergenic digital currency platforms lies in their commitment to providing a secure and navigable environment. Features such as two-factor authentication, end-to-end encryption, and real-time monitoring for suspicious activities are standard practices that enhance user trust and security. Moreover, these platforms often undergo regular security audits to ensure they adhere to the highest standards of digital safety.
